Action Planning Template | ||||
Goal: To improve the math fact fluency for our current 6th graders and use my data to prompt current Elementary teachers to stress the importance of learning multiplication facts. | ||||
Action Steps(s): | Person(s) Responsible: | Timeline: Start/End | Needed Resources | Evaluation |
Design and distribute a pre-test on basic math facts. It will be a timed test to determine the students level of fluency. | Jennifer Gerbrecht | December 9, 2011 | Timed test, stopwatch | How many problems are answered correctly in two minutes |
Grade the pre-tests and record the information on a spreadsheet | Jennifer Gerbrecht | December 9 to December 16, 2011 | Spreadsheet and computer | |
Explain the purpose of the study groups we will be forming to the students | Jennifer Gerbrecht | January 5, 2012 | | |
Begin daily 15 minutes of multiplication facts study | Jennifer Gerbrecht | January 9, 2012 To May 18, 2012 | The game 24, laptops, worksheets, flash cards, Promethean board | Monthly progress monitoring sheet |
Self- Reflection | Jennifer Gerbrecht, Kelly Jackson Principal and Janet Hasse math department head | Ongoing | Spreadsheets and journal, meet with site supervisor and department head | |
Compare the findings of the study based on those who were not participating. I will test both at the end of the year to see if there is a huge improvement for those who were exposed. | Jennifer Gerbrecht | May 21-25, 2012 | Spreadsheets and data charts | Compare the results |
